## Authentication

Matchbox (the pairing service) exposes GC pause metrics at `/internal/gc`. Pauses over 400ms page on-call. The endpoint is behind the Kestrelgate proxy; anonymous calls return 403. Auth is a static service key in the `X-Matchbox-Key` header — no OAuth, no refresh. Keys rotate quarterly; stale keys fail closed, which looks identical to a network partition, so check auth first. The current on-call key for the GC metrics endpoint is below.

API key for kahap-faduf: vxb23-Ir087IkWYmBJt7KRtkyhUA3

Ticket: Crashfall ingest failing on staging

New folks, please read carefully. The Pebblekit mobile app's crash reports aren't reaching the symbolication queue because staging's env file was copied without its upload credential. Symptoms: 401s in the collector logs every five minutes. To fix, add the missing line to the env file, exactly as follows.

secret setting of fafop-tagep: VAULT_KEY29=6a815d21e2d77cc25ef1802d73ee6

Runbook: TileHarbor prefetcher (Ostrev Maps platform). Before any restart, confirm the prefetch queue has drained — check the depth gauge on the Ostrev dashboard and wait until it reads below 500. Restarting mid-batch can duplicate tile writes, which the dedupe job won't catch for six hours. If in doubt, ask in the maps-infra channel first. The drain procedure is documented at the page linked below.

dashboard of kajep-tajog = https://harbor.tolvaqworks.example/pipeline/run/dash/pipeline/228e278bbf9b3bc2

Onboarding note for the Ledgerpane admin table: bulk edits are applied through the batcher service, not directly against the database. Select rows, choose an action, and the batcher stages changes in a pending set you can review before commit. Edits over 500 rows require a second approver — this is enforced server-side, so don't try to chunk around it. To run the batcher locally you need the staging write credential, which goes in your .env as the next line.

secret setting of bahip-kagag: RELAY_SECRET3=c83